New Look drives mcommerce sales by more than 500pc

The company worked with Mobile Interactive Group to build the site. Within three months since its launch in April, New Look has seen the fully transactional mobile site, far exceed key performance indicators with conversions at times outstripping Internet transactions, the company claims.

Results
Since the mobile site launch, New Look saw an increase in orders of more than 60 percent and an increase in revenue of more than 45 percent.

The company worked with Mobile Interactive Group to create a feature-rich mobile shopping experience that offers customers an easy and convenient way to shop whenever they choose.

The New Look mobile site

The site includes features such as ‘One Click’ purchasing, as well as browse, zoom and view functionality.

Site functionality
The company also leveraged HTML5 to deliver product zooming and spinning.

Consumers can browse products in one, two or three column formats.

Additionally, the site lets users locate their nearest store and use social networking to share products via Facebook, Twitter and email.

New Look is looking to develop more offerings to consumers to expand its reach in the mobile space.
